Surpac Error Loading Jvmdll — 2021 Top [work]

Surpac has its own configuration file that tells it which Java executable to use.

Locate your desktop shortcut or the executable file ( surpac.exe ). Right-click the icon and choose Run as administrator .

Download the latest supported Visual C++ redistributable packages from the Microsoft website.

To understand the error, one must first grasp the role of jvm.dll (Java Virtual Machine Dynamic Link Library). Surpac, particularly versions from 2021, relies on Java for specific modules—including the block model editor, certain reporting tools, and the visual scripting engine. When Surpac launches, it calls upon this DLL to instantiate a Java Virtual Machine (JVM) within its own process space. The “Error loading JVM.dll” is not a file corruption message per se ; it is a . The operating system or Surpac’s launcher cannot locate, access, or correctly bind to a compatible version of this library. surpac error loading jvmdll 2021 top

The is a classic example of modern software dependency complexity. It is rarely a sign that Surpac itself is broken; rather, it indicates a broken link in the chain linking Surpac to the Java environment.

The "Error loading JVMDLL" message typically occurs when Surpac tries to load the Java Virtual Machine (JVM) DLL, which is required for the software to function properly. This error can manifest in different ways, such as:

The critical message in GEOVIA Surpac prevents the software from initiating its user interface subsystem. This error breaks down the essential bridge between the main C++ framework of the software and its Java-based graphical tools. Surpac has its own configuration file that tells

Right-click each downloaded installer and select .

Uninstall the current Java version via Windows Control Panel.

: Right-click the Surpac icon > Properties > Compatibility tab. Set it to Windows 7 or Windows 8 to see if it resolves startup conflicts. Summary Checklist for Surpac 2021 SYSTEM REQUIREMENTS GEOVIA SURPAC™ When Surpac launches, it calls upon this DLL

Find the Path variable, click , and verify that the entry pointing to your Java bin directory (e.g., C:\Program Files\Java\jre1.8.x\bin ) is prioritized near the top of the list. 4. Match the Application Bit Version

If Surpac displays the jvm.dll error at startup, the application is failing to bridge itself to the local Java environment. This typically stems from a few underlying causes:

GEOVIA Surpac relies heavily on Java to run its core user interface (UI) elements, macros, and foundational menus. The jvm.dll file acts as the primary entry point for software applications to embed and run Java natively within a Windows environment.

Install both the and x64 versions, as many background processes require both. 5. Antivirus and Permissions